Transaction 231f88e87f7bb639354c7a36c25f26fcc94b14d08b34f37aaff31da567c9c832

block
122fe292a405f1e26cfecd94e752bb13e8841ac8b02e17fa130a0ca0fa853aa0

77 Inputs

2 Outputs